Let me share some holiday thoughts from the past, from President Reagan as he was lighting the National Christmas Tree:


"May we give thanks for a free America, an America united in the wonder of a season that includes not only Christmas but Hanukkah as well. And as we light this glorious tree, may Nancy and I offer a final wish to all Americans: that every Christmas that follows will be as full of joy as we have these past years to work in your service. May God bless you all."


Remarks on Lighting the National Christmas Tree, December 15, 1988
